Output 45e411380d66a2e168fc716201328ad4e29d963c93a32a4dfd8b3cecc587c754:24

value
5302885
script pubkey
OP_0 OP_PUSHBYTES_20 bb039616de0a5db24849bfb80394f91f50b7ae1a
address
bc1qhvpev9k7pfwmyjzfh7uq898eragt0ts6jer0hq
transaction
45e411380d66a2e168fc716201328ad4e29d963c93a32a4dfd8b3cecc587c754